Abstract
A physiological condition detecting method detects pulse waves from the body of a patient, and creates the envelope of the pulse waves by connecting every peak of the pulse waves. It determines that the patient is in non-REM sleep, if the envelope fluctuates regularly. It determines that the patient is in REM sleep, if the envelope fluctuates irregularly. Further the method calculates and normalizes the amplitude and period of the envelope. It determines whether the patient has obstructive sleep apnea syndrome based on the normalized amplitude. It determines whether the patient has central sleep apnea syndrome based on the normalized period. It determines that the patient has mixed sleep apnea syndrome based on the normalized amplitude and the normalized period.

6. A method for detecting a sleep condition of a patient comprising the steps of:
-
detecting pulse waves from the sleeping patient'"'"'s body;
creating an envelope of the pulse waves by connecting one of tops and bottoms of the pulse waves;
determining that the patient is in non-REM sleep if the envelope fluctuates regularly; and
determining that the patient is in REM sleep if the envelope fluctuates irregularly. - View Dependent Claims (9, 12, 15)
